Top 5 First Person Games on iOS in Latin America: Q1 2022

In the first quarter of 2022, the top 5 first-person games on iOS in Latin America exhibited varied trends in we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ed performance breakdown for each game.

Call of Duty®: Mobile saw significant fluctuations in we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$301.9K in the last week of March. Weekly downloads ranged from around 63K to 82K, with a slight decline towards the end of the quarter. Active users were consistently high, starting at 948.5K and ending at 817.6K.

Minecraft experienced a gradual decline in weekly revenue, starting at $107.6K and dropping to roughly $69.3K by the end of March. Downloads also decreased, beginning at 3.7K and ending at 2.9K. Active users showed a similar downward trend, from 344.7K to 288.9K.

Cooking Madness-Kitchen Frenzy maintained a steady weekly revenue, peaking at $24.4K in mid-January and ending the quarter at around $10.5K. Downloads fluctuated, starting at 24.3K, dipping mid-quarter, and finishing at 7.4K. Active users followed a downward trend from 134.6K to 83.1K.

Sniper 3D: Gun Shooting Games had consistent weekly revenue, with a peak of $20.7K in mid-January and ending at $11.5K. Downloads varied, starting at 36.5K, peaking at 41.1K, and ending at 21.1K. Active users remained stable, starting at 101.7K and ending at 82.3K.

Chapters: Interactive Stories saw a significant drop in weekly revenue, starting at $10.5K and ending at $8.2K. Downloads decreased from 7.1K to 3.1K, while active users fell from 31.5K to 21.3K over the quarter.
